Помощь - Поиск - Пользователи - Календарь
Полная версия этой страницы: Вопросы по лицензии на Nios II и не только
Форум разработчиков электроники ELECTRONIX.ru > Программируемая логика ПЛИС (FPGA,CPLD, PLD) > Системы на ПЛИС - System on a Programmable Chip (SoPC)
s.i.suprun
Доброго времени суток ,товарищи форумчане!!!
Подскажите пожалуйста, те кто пользовал Nios II:
- возможно ли его использование из-под QUARTUS, который имеет фришную лицензию, в реальных разработках (а то при компиляции выскакивает сообщение time-limited ) для длительного использования;
- также интересует вопрос с лицензиями на некоторые ядра, как то ЮСБ, который входит в 8-й квартус, лицензию я выписал, но она на пол года (тоже фри), так вот вопрос, если я сгенерю соф файл, и буду его только заливать в ПЛИС, без любых модификаций, будет ли это ядро работать по истечении периода этой лицензии, или же готовое устройство с этим ядром не потухнет после лицензионного периода?
-Вопрос по поводу Циклона 3 : на какой максимальной частоте я могу его завести?
-Кто-нибудь запускал на Niose какую нибудь RTOS (uC/OS, uCLinux), так вот как она себя чувствует , способна ли она обрабатывать изображение (15 кадров в сек), производить перемножение чисел с плавающей запятой, потянет ли она эту задачу, если ее поднять на 3-м Циклоне?
Kuzmi4
2 s.i.suprun - есть лицензия - поделитесь с народом. Он вас не забудет

На счёт
Цитата
на какой максимальной частоте я могу его завести?

Что вы понимаете под словом завести?
Если имеете ввиду ниос2 - то где то думаю на мегагерцах 100 или того порядка - видел инфу на сайте для 2-го циклона - там как раз 100 с копейками была (165 что ли). Точно не скажу - точно ищите на сайте альтеры..

На счёт ртос - есть сведения о uCLinux на спартане - всё работало, но тормозило по страшному.
Кстати, тут не так давно ветка была как раз на счёт зачем плисы на нужны, вроде тоже этот вопрос затрагивали - всё что вы хотите лучше в железе реализовать - а ниос на крайняк дирижёром поставить или добавить туда своюпериферию и сделать обработчиком.. тут мнения разные есть..
Но если вы возьмёте какой ли арм - то работать ось под ним будет быстрей однозначно...

И что значит
Цитата
обрабатывать изображение

Что вы под этим понимаете?..обрабатывать их можно по разному..

На счёт лицензии же к юсб - скорей всего будет работть и после срока - не представляю как им туда тайм-бомбу засунуть - этож не эмбедед XP..
vadimuzzz
обработку изображений и прочие числодробилки лучше вынести в железо.
RTOS несколько для другого. много инфы тут:
www.niosforum.com
Syberian
Цитата
- возможно ли его использование из-под QUARTUS, который имеет фришную лицензию, в реальных разработках (а то при компиляции выскакивает сообщение time-limited ) для длительного использования;

Возможно, только через час твоя разработка уйдет в halt до перезапуска. Надо Plain-text HDL лиценцию.


Цитата
- также интересует вопрос с лицензиями на некоторые ядра, как то ЮСБ, который входит в 8-й квартус, лицензию я выписал, но она на пол года (тоже фри), так вот вопрос, если я сгенерю соф файл, и буду его только заливать в ПЛИС, без любых модификаций, будет ли это ядро работать по истечении периода этой лицензии, или же готовое устройство с этим ядром не потухнет после лицензионного периода?

Потухнет через час. Чтоб не тухло, смотри тему "ква...8.0" в разделе "i have a program"
Там и про Ниос plain-text строчка включена

Цитата
-Вопрос по поводу Циклона 3 : на какой максимальной частоте я могу его завести?

Собери простой логический элемент (адна штюка), скомпилируй и посмотри Fmax smile.gif (ага, я проктолог lol.gif )
Цитата
-Кто-нибудь запускал на Niose какую нибудь RTOS (uC/OS, uCLinux), так вот как она себя чувствует , способна ли она обрабатывать изображение (15 кадров в сек), производить перемножение чисел с плавающей запятой, потянет ли она эту задачу, если ее поднять на 3-м Циклоне?

Запускал ниос на Циклоне 2 (с большим трудом влезло). Очень тупой проц, как вычислитель. Максимум 50 MIPS, 16 MFLOPS. Тормознейшая работа с шиной!!! Про изображения и часть вокодеров забудь. Программно будет медленно, а аппаратная вставка вместе с ниосом не влезает в чип.
Просто быстрый микроконтроллер для управления обвязкой из логики на том же кристалле. Не больше.
Stewart Little
Цитата(Syberian @ Aug 25 2008, 07:21) *
Запускал ниос на Циклоне 2 (с большим трудом влезло). Очень тупой проц, как вычислитель. Максимум 50 MIPS, 16 MFLOPS.

Тогда уж уточняйте, в какой именно циклон2 (лог.емкость, speed grade), и какой именно вариант ядра (economy, standard, fast) запихивали. Без этого Ваша информация, мягко говоря, не полная.

Цитата(Syberian @ Aug 25 2008, 07:21) *
Тормознейшая работа с шиной!!!

Опять-таки, что использовали - Avalon MM или Streaming?

Ниос2 штука довольно гибкая, его можно оптимально конфигурировать под конкретную задачу (есс-но, при этом нужно грамотно разделить реализацию на аппаратую и программную составляющие).
Kuzmi4
2 Stewart Little - в принципе и через Avalon MM используя burstcount можно неплохо пакетныей данные гнать - я там развивал одновремя эту тему - один товарисч даже вроде взялся ваять это дело для себя, но что-то тема заглохла...
Хотя с другой стороны зачем делать через Ж.. если можно заюзать Streaming smile.gif
Syberian
Цитата
Опять-таки, что использовали - Avalon MM или Streaming?


использовали IORD() и IORW() smile.gif Тапками не кидать! Стреаминг был совсем не к месту.
Для просмотра полной версии этой страницы, пожалуйста, пройдите по ссылке.
Invision Power Board © 2001-2025 Invision Power Services, Inc.